Discovering the Professional Home Care Benefits
Professional home care benefits go far beyond simple assistance. They create a personalized experience tailored to individual needs, allowing people to stay in familiar surroundings while receiving the help they deserve. Imagine waking up each day knowing that someone is there to support you with everything from meal preparation to medication reminders, all while respecting your pace and preferences.
Some of the key advantages include:
Personalized Care Plans: Every person is unique, and so is their care. Professional caregivers work closely with clients and families to design plans that fit specific needs and lifestyles.
Companionship and Emotional Support: Loneliness can be a heavy burden. Having a friendly face to talk to, share stories, or simply sit quietly with you can brighten even the toughest days.
Safety and Fall Prevention: Caregivers are trained to recognize hazards and assist with mobility, reducing the risk of falls and accidents at home.
Flexibility and Convenience: Whether you need a few hours a day or round-the-clock care, professional services can adapt to your schedule and changing needs.
Peace of Mind for Families: Knowing that a trusted professional is looking after your loved one brings comfort and relief to family members.
These benefits combine to create a nurturing environment where independence is encouraged, and support is always within reach.

Does Medicare Pay for a Caregiver at Home?
One of the most common questions I hear is about Medicare coverage for in-home care. It’s important to understand what Medicare does and does not cover to plan effectively.
Medicare typically covers short-term skilled nursing care or therapy services at home after a hospital stay. However, it generally does not cover long-term non-medical care, such as assistance with daily living activities like bathing, dressing, or meal preparation.
Here’s what you should know:
Medicare Part A may cover some home health care if it is medically necessary and ordered by a doctor.
Medicare Part B covers outpatient therapy services but not custodial care.
Long-term personal care usually requires private pay, long-term care insurance, or assistance programs.

Choosing the Right Home Care Provider: What to Look For
Selecting a home care provider is a deeply personal decision. It’s about trust, compatibility, and quality. Here are some practical tips to guide you:
Check Credentials and Licensing: Ensure the agency is licensed and caregivers are properly trained.
Ask About Caregiver Matching: A good provider matches caregivers to clients based on personality, skills, and preferences.
Look for Personalized Care Plans: Avoid one-size-fits-all approaches. Your needs should shape the care.
Read Reviews and Get References: Hearing from others can provide valuable insights.
Evaluate Communication and Responsiveness: The agency should be easy to reach and quick to address concerns.
Consider Local Experience: Providers familiar with your area understand community resources and can offer better support.
Taking the time to research and ask questions ensures that the care you receive feels like a natural extension of your home life.
